Python是一种广泛使用的高级编程语言,以其简洁明了的语法和强大的功能而闻名。它支持跨平台操作,可以在Windows、Linux、Mac OS等操作系统上运行。Python是开源的,这意味着它的源代码对公众开放,允许开发者自由地使用、修改和分发。Python还具有解释型特性,即代码不需要预先编译,而是逐行解释执行,这使得Python成为快速开发和原型设计的理想选择。 Python有两种主要的版本:Python 2.x和Python 3.x。Python 3.x是当前的发展方向,其语法和功能更加现代化,且已被广泛采用。如果你是初学者,推荐选择Python 3.x进行学习。在多版本共存的环境中,可以通过调整系统环境变量`PATH`来切换不同的Python版本。 安装Python后,你可以通过"IDLE (Python GUI)"启动解释器,查看当前安装的Python版本。IDLE是Python自带的一个集成开发环境,提供了交互式的编程环境。在IDLE中,你可以直接在提示符">>>"后输入Python代码进行测试和调试。此外,还有许多其他的开发环境,如Eclipse搭配PyDev、PyCharm、wingIDE、Eric、PythonWin以及Anaconda等,这些都提供了更丰富的功能和更好的开发体验。 Python的安装通常从官方网站下载相应版本的安装包完成。安装完成后,你可以使用IDLE或其他IDE编写Python程序,并通过"Check Module"或"Run Module"功能检查语法或运行程序。在命令行环境中,你可以通过导航到Python程序文件所在目录并执行该文件来运行程序。 Python中的`pip`工具是用于管理第三方包的重要工具,它可以方便地安装、升级和卸载Python库。例如,你可以使用`pip install package_name`命令来安装特定的库。 Python的核心概念之一是对象模型,一切皆为对象。Python提供了许多内置对象,如数字、字符串、列表、字典等,可以直接在代码中使用。非内置对象则需要导入相应的模块,如数学函数、随机数生成等。Python中的变量不需要预先声明类型,只需赋值即可创建对象,这种动态类型特性使得代码更灵活,减少了类型检查带来的额外工作。 Python是一种功能强大、易学易用的编程语言,适合初学者入门,也适合专业开发者的高效开发。通过掌握Python的基础知识,你可以涉足数据科学、Web开发、自动化脚本等多个领域,利用其丰富的库和工具解决各种问题。
剩余99页未读,继续阅读
- 粉丝: 9852
- 资源: 4073
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助